**Runbook: Dark mode in the Quillboard admin dashboard**

Dark mode is served per-user via a theme flag resolved at login. If users report unreadable charts or a flash of light theme, the theme resolver cache has likely gone stale; flush it and ask the user to re-login. Do not toggle the global theme flag during business hours. The resolver reads its behavior from the configuration below.

service settings:
PRAWYN_PIN=9848
PRAWYN_METRICS_HOST=metrics.prawyn.lumicworks.corp
PRAWYN_LOG_LEVEL=warn
PRAWYN_TENANT=pelius

## LiftSim 4.2 — changed defaults

Defaults changed for the elevator-dispatch simulator. Idle-return behavior is now zoning-aware; old round-robin mode removed. Peak-traffic model defaults to the Harlowe morning profile. Car capacity sampling is stochastic by default — set it explicitly if you need deterministic runs. Regression baselines regenerated; old ones won't match. New installs and upgrades both pick up the following default configuration values:

deployment values, taweg-bajop:
[fenvan]
port = 5672
team = holmir
host = fenvan.orvexio.example
region = lower-1
access_code = ac_b98bc6
timeout_ms = 1500

Capacity note for the Bramblewick export retry queue. Failed exports are requeued with exponential backoff, and the queue depth is our main capacity signal: sustained depth above the high-water mark means downstream Pellis storage is saturated, not that we need more workers. As the new contractor, please don't raise worker counts without checking storage latency first — it usually makes things worse. Retry timing, backoff caps, and the high-water threshold are all driven by the constants shown below.

limits module of yagef-bajog:
TIERS = {
    "druael": 370,
    "tamix": 286,
    "pelius": 541,
    "pelael": 78,
    "pelox": 47,
    "ralath": 533,
    "drumir": 801,
}